No the buckets arn't the same at all. The meguiars ones are the genuine Grit Guard ones so very tough and a 100% perfect fit for the grit guard. These retail for £18 on their own. You can get the generic ones used primarilly in the caterting industry for a couple of quid of ebay. I shall stock those and knock £8 of the price if you would prefer that. The towels also cost double, but I'm getting some of the small ones in stock this week so can do a like for like kit so it won't be so expensive.
